Egg Bound in Hens: Causes & Prevention Guide

Egg binding (being “egg bound”) is a serious and potentially life-threatening condition in laying hens when an egg becomes stuck in the oviduct and cannot be passed naturally. Chicken Dust Bath Essentials: What to Include for Healthy Feathers

Dust bathing is an instinctive behavior in chickens that supports feather condition, skin health, and parasite control. A well-prepared dust bath area allows birds to maintain their plumage, regulate oil and moisture, and reduce external parasites like mites and lice. Can Bumblefoot Kill a Chicken? Prevention & Treatment Guide

Bumblefoot, or pododermatitis, is a common foot condition in chickens characterized by infection and inflammation of the footpad. While often seen as a manageable ailment, if left untreated or if severe, bumblefoot can lead to serious complications—including systemic infection—that may ultimately be fatal.
